I think I need another SIM card with good IDD rates. Cant leave my old one as need to keep the number. Anywhere to get the dual holder and is there a place that will cut the 2 cards? Or is that a bad idea?
Why not just get a decent phonecard (this doesn't involve changing your SIM/number). Or sign your mobile up for 0080 or 0060 or any of the postpaid IDD services... I don't understand why you feel access to a fixed line is relevant - for many HK phonecards calling from a mobile is cheaper than calling from a fixed line anyway.

You can trivially get to HKD$68 per month all you can eat, or to about HK$0.38/min pay as you go. If you really shop around you can get down to HK$0.20/min.
